    1.8 kW Solar Generator Output Explained

    A 1.8 kW solar generator provides a maximum output of 1,800 watts. This capacity allows for the operation of multiple devices simultaneously, but the actual runtime depends on the energy consumption of each device. It’s crucial to calculate the total wattage of appliances you plan to run to ensure you stay within the generator’s limits.

    Understanding the wattage of common appliances helps in planning usage effectively. Below is a list of typical household items and their average wattage requirements:

    Appliance Average Wattage
    LED Light Bulb 10-15 watts
    Refrigerator 100-800 watts
    Microwave 600-1,200 watts
    Laptop 50-100 watts
    TV 100-400 watts

    Knowing these values allows for better management of your solar generator’s output.

    Monthly costs associated with a 1.8 kW solar generator can vary significantly based on usage and local electricity rates. Here’s how to estimate your monthly expenses:

    1. Calculate Daily Usage
      Multiply the total wattage of appliances by the hours used daily.

    2. Convert to kWh
      Divide the total watt-hours by 1,000 to convert to kilowatt-hours (kWh).

    3. Multiply by Local Rate
      Multiply the kWh by your local electricity rate to find monthly costs.

    Assuming you run a refrigerator (500 watts) for 24 hours and a laptop (75 watts) for 8 hours, the calculation would be:

    • Refrigerator: 500 watts x 24 hours = 12,000 watt-hours (12 kWh)

    • Laptop: 75 watts x 8 hours = 600 watt-hours (0.6 kWh)

    Total daily usage = 12 kWh + 0.6 kWh = 12.6 kWh

    If your local electricity rate is $0.12 per kWh:

    • Monthly cost = 12.6 kWh x 30 days x $0.12 = $45.36

    When using a solar generator, consider potential extra fees that may arise. These can include:

    • Maintenance Costs
      Regular maintenance of the solar generator and battery can incur costs.

    • Replacement Parts
      Batteries may need replacement every few years, adding to overall expenses.

    • Installation Fees
      If you opt for professional installation, this can significantly increase initial costs.

    1.8 kW Solar Generator Seasonal Performance Factors

    The performance of a 1.8 kW solar generator can vary with the seasons. During winter months, shorter days and inclement weather can reduce solar output. It’s advisable to have a backup power source or additional batteries to ensure consistent energy supply.
